Method 1: Direct Conversion Using the Conversion Factor

The most straightforward method to convert 287 km/h to mph involves using the conversion factor between kilometers and miles. As mentioned earlier, 1 kilometer is approximately equal to 0.621371 miles.

287 km/h * 0.621371 miles/km ≈ 178.26 mph

This calculation directly translates the speed from kilometers per hour to miles per hour. And the result, approximately 178. 26 mph, shows that 287 km/h is considerably faster than it might initially appear when considering only the numerical value.
